Lifting points ensure a safe connection of load and sling. In this product category you will find:
Weld-on hooks
Eyebolts
Ring nuts
Swivel hooks
You will also find information on rigid and swivel anchor points in screwable or weldable design in various load capacities. Special anchor points for PPE against falling or in stainless steel design offer optimal solutions for your individual application.

Available in UNC and Metric thread sizes.
UNC threads available in sizes fom 650 pounds to 29,000 pounds Working Load Limit, with a design factor of 5 to 1.
Metric threads available in sizes from 300kg to 13,000kg and dual rated in both a 4 to 1 and 5 to 1 design factor.
360° swivel and 180° pivot action.
100% individually proof tested to 21/2 times the Working Load Limit with certification and Statistically Magnetic Particle inspected. (Can be furnished 100% Magnetic Particle inspected when requested at time of order). Bolts are individually Proof Tested.
Fatigue rated to 20,000 cycles at 11/2 times the Working Load Limit.
Bolt is secured with patented retaining ring which requires no modification to threads. This method allows for easy disassembly and assembly of hoist ring for thorough examination of all components. Replacement kits are available.
Top washer has the following features: The Working Load Limit and Recommended Torque value are permanently stamped into each washer.

360° rotatable lifting point. The load ring is loadable in a range of 130° and can be positioned at any required angle due to its replaceable and patented spring. Likewise interchangeable is the hexagon-special screw from grade 10.9 material, which is secured against loss. The screw is 100% crack detection tested as well as covered with a chromate VI-free protection against corrosion.
pewag winner profilift alpha is able to withstand a 4-fold safety against break in all directions. It is avaliable with metric or UNC-thread, whereas the lifting points with metric thread is also obtainable with customized thread lengths.
Permissible usage
Load capacity acc. to the inspection certificate respectively table of WLL in the mentioned directions of pull (see picture 1).
Non permissible usage
Make sure when choosing the assembly that improper load can not arise e.g. if:
The direction of pull is obstructed
Direction of pull is not in the foreseen area (see picture 2)
Load ring rests against edges or loads (picture 3)
The load ring must be placed in the direction of pull before loading - do not turn under load. For more details please have a look into our user manual.
To calculate the necessary thread length (L):
L = H + S +K + X
H = Material height
S = Thickness of the washer
K = Height of the nut (depending on the thread size of the screw)
X = Excess length of the screw (twofold pitch of the screw)
L max. = n max.
pewag provides, along with the standard and maximum thread lengths, specially customised thread lengths. Supplied customised and maxium thread lengths include a washer and a crack-tested, corrosion-proofed screw nut.

Pewag winner profilift gamma supreme – tighten by hand, then align in the load direction, a lifting point that has been developed and produced with the new standards in mind. The patented system has proven itself from the beginning.
It is 360° rotatable, contains a patented and interchangeable special screw, which is 100% crack-tested as well as covered with a chrome VI-free finish-protection against corrosion and marked with WLL and thread size.
Tool-free assembly and disassembly.
The latch in pos.1 does not have any contact with the screw (picture 1).
The latch is kept in position with a patented spring
Eye bolt is rotatable
The latch in pos. 2 has contact with the screw (picture 2).
The latch is kept in position with a patented spring
Eye bolt is not rotatable i.e. the fastening torque is transmitted to the screw and thus the eye bolt can be (re)assembled.
A considerably simplified alternative is the pewag PLGW pewag winner profilift gamma basic. With the same benefits as the pewag PLGW supreme in terms of measurement, carrying capacity and application, the pewag PLGW basic differs solely in the assembly: mounting and removing requires the use of a hexagon Allen wrench.

Screwable, 360° rotatable lifting point. The load ring is 180° movable and can be positioned at any required angle due to its replaceable and patented spring. Likewise interchangeable is the hexagon-special screw of grade 10.9 material, which is secured against loss.
The screw is 100% crack-tested as well as covered with a chromate VI-free protection against corrosion. It can be tightened with a hexagon wrench or spanner wrench.
Pewag winner profilift beta is available with metric or UNC-thread, whereas the lifting points with metric thread are also obtainable with customized thread lengths.
Permissible usage
Load capacity acc. to the inspection certificate respectively table of WLL in the mentioned directions of pull – see picture 1 and 2.
Non permissible usage
Make sure when choosing the assembly that improper load can not arise e.g. if:
The direction of pull is obstructed.
Direction of pull is not in the foreseen area (see picture 3).
Loading ring rests against edges or load (picture 4).
The load ring must be placed in the direction of pull before loading – do not turn under load.
To calculate the necessary thread length (L):
L= H + S + K + X
H = Material height
S = Thickness of the washer
K = Height of the nut (depending on the thread size of the screw)
X = Excess length of the screw (twofold pitch of the screw)
L max. = n max.
pewag provides, along with the standard and maximum thread lengths, specially customised thread lengths. Supplied customised and maxium thread lengths include a washer and a crack-tested, corrosion-proofed screw nut.

SS FE DSR M Stainless steel female double swivel ring.
The stainless steel version of the double swivel ring, FE.DSR, can be used in humid, corrosive, chemical, maritime environment. Its double articulation allows it to line up perfectly with the sling
